BLF文件批量转CSV用Python怎么高效实现?
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
Python内容推荐
python实现csv格式文件转为asc格式文件的方法
首先,文章标题为“python实现csv格式文件转为asc格式文件的方法”,从标题我们得知,这篇文章将会详细讲述如何使用Python编程语言来实现CSV格式文件向ASC格式文件的转换。CSV,全称为逗号分隔值文件,是一种常用的...
cantools python语言 ,can dbc文件自动生成 excel 、C语言代码
标题中的“cantools”是一个基于Python的开源工具,主要用于处理CAN(Controller Area Network)数据,尤其是DBC(Database Description Files)格式的文件。DBC文件是CAN网络中用于描述信号、帧和节点之间关系的...
基于Python的对 汽车电子ECU的通信矩阵数据库文件(.dbc)的解析
本教程将深入探讨如何使用Python来解析DBC文件,从而实现自动化测试、批量信号处理和报文分析。 首先,我们需要了解DBC文件的结构。DBC文件包含了以下关键元素: 1. **信号(Signal)**:信号代表了ECU间传输的...
【Python编程】NumPy数组操作与广播机制深度解析
内容概要:本文系统讲解NumPy多维数组的核心操作,重点对比ndarray与Python列表在内存布局、向量化运算、广播规则上的本质差异。文章从C连续与F连续内存顺序出发,详解视图(view)与副本(copy)的引用语义、花式索引(fancy indexing)的数组拷贝行为、以及结构化数组的复合数据类型。通过性能基准测试展示ufunc通用函数的SIMD加速、广播机制在形状不匹配数组运算中的自动扩展规则、以及einsum爱因斯坦求和约定的灵活张量操作,同时介绍memmap大数组内存映射、record array的数据库式字段访问、以及NumPy与Cython的混合加速策略,最后给出在图像处理、数值模拟、机器学习特征工程等场景下的数组优化技巧与内存管理建议。
26年电工杯AB题超级棒电力系统Python、Matlab代码、论文
内容概要:本文围绕光伏系统并网及电能质量改善的核心目标,提出一种基于级联前馈神经网络(CFNN)与深度神经网络(DNN)协同控制的智能控制方案,用于级联多电平逆变器。该方案通过构建感知层、控制层与执行层的三层架构,实现对逆变器开关状态的快速响应与精准校正,有效抑制总谐波失真(THD),提升并网效率与系统稳定性。研究摆脱了对精确系统数学模型的依赖,利用机器学习算法挖掘运行数据中的非线性关系,实现低次与高次谐波的分层抑制。理论分析与性能对比表明,该方案在THD、功率因数和响应时间等指标上均优于传统PI控制和单一前馈神经网络控制,具备更高的控制精度与自适应能力,满足电网并网标准,为光伏微电网的大规模应用提供了可靠的技术路径。; 适合人群:具备一定电力电子、自动控制与机器学习基础的科研人员、研究生及从事新能源系统开发的工程技术人员。; 使用场景及目标:① 解决光伏发电并网过程中的电能质量问题,特别是总谐波失真的抑制;② 提升逆变器在光照波动与电网扰动工况下的动态响应能力与控制鲁棒性;③ 为研究基于人工智能的电力电子控制系统设计提供可复现的算法框架与技术参考。; 阅读建议:此资源融合了电力系统、神经网络与控制理论,建议读者结合文中提供的Matlab/Simulink仿真模型与代码实现,深入理解协同控制策略的设计逻辑与参数整定方法,并通过实际数据训练验证模型性能,以实现理论与实践的深度融合。
windows can blf 格式转换工具
windows can blf 格式转换工具,转换完成后生成csv 格式,可以用excel 或者notepad ++ 打开 ,方便进行debug ...
CAN总线BLF采集文件转CSV文件小程序
标题中的“CAN总线BLF采集文件转CSV文件小程序”是指一个专门用于处理CAN(Controller Area Network)总线数据的小程序。CAN总线是一种广泛应用在汽车、工业自动化、楼宇自动化等领域的多主通信网络,它允许不同的...
csvconverter(csv文件转换器)V1.0汉化版
csv converter是一款免费的CSV...csv converter使用方法 首先选择要转换的CSV文件,或带有CSV文件的文件夹,选择转换后的保存位置,下一步后,设置转换常用选项,最后点击转换按钮就能转换后,转换速度快精度高。
BLF文件格式介绍文档
### BLF 文件格式详解 #### 一、简介 BLF(Binary Logging Format)是一种由Vector Informatik GmbH开发的专业日志记录格式,主要用于记录车载网络通信数据,如CAN(Controller Area Network)、LIN(Local ...
基于LabVIEW编写的csv格式文件转换为asc格式文件
本软件目的:汽车CAN总线接收的数据存为csv文件,但是CANoe不能解析此格式文件,需转换成asc文件或blf文件 本软件的内容:将csv格式文件打开,并对其数据进行处理,存储为asc文件,包含替换等功能。(可根据使用需求...
BLF格式转ASC格式(CAN录像报文),方便以txt文档打开,分析CAN报文
用户可以使用各种文本处理工具,比如Excel,进行排序、筛选、统计等工作,或者使用编程语言如Python进行自动化处理和分析。此外,ASC文件还经常用于数据交换,因为它很容易被不同的系统和分析工具所接受。 通过将...
BLF文件解析工程-.c-.h-数据-vs工程源代码
在本工程中,开发者需要实现读取、解析以及可能的处理和转换BLF文件中的数据功能。 **C语言基础** C语言是一种强大的、低级别的编程语言,被广泛用于系统级编程、嵌入式开发以及各种软件工程。在这个项目中,C语言...
Simulink打开Canoe保存的blf文件
要在Simulink中使用这些BLF文件,我们需要遵循以下步骤: 1. **导入Canoe的BLF文件**:首先,确保你已经安装了MATLAB的CAN接口工具箱。这个工具箱提供了与Canoe交互的接口。在Simulink环境中,选择“模型”->“导入...
peak-convert.rar
标签“.trc转.asc”和“.trc转.csv”揭示了这个转换过程不仅限于ASC格式,也可能支持将TRC文件转换为CSV(Comma Separated Values)格式。CSV是一种通用的数据交换格式,易于在不同的应用程序之间导入和导出。转换为...
基于LabVIEW编写的csv格式文件转换为asc格式文件 本软件目的:
基于LabVIEW编写的csv格式文件转换为asc格式文件 本软件目的:汽车CAN总线接收的数据存为csv文件,但是CANoe不能解析此格式文件,需转换成asc文件或blf文件 本软件的内容:将csv格式文件打开,并对其数据进行处理,...
基于LabVIEW编写的csv格式文件转换为asc格式文件 本软件目的:汽
基于LabVIEW编写的csv格式文件转换为asc格式文件 本软件目的:汽车CAN总线接收的数据存为csv文件,但是CANoe不能解析此格式文件,需转换成asc文件或blf文件 本软件的内容:将csv格式文件打开,并对其数据进行处理,...
CANoe程序示例,BLF文件解析库、头文件、程序代码,转ASC格式示例
里面包含了CANoe的所有程序示例,适合对BLF文件解析的二次开发,包括:Bitmap_Library BLF_Logging CAPLdll COMDotNet COM_Automation ControlPlugin C_Library MenuPlugin MMSoundDll Python vFlashAutomation VS_...
BLF说明文档-can数据的一种
BLF格式的主要特点是使用二进制格式记录数据,使得数据记录和分析更加快速和高效。BLF格式记录的数据包括CAN总线上的消息、错误信息、状态信息等。 在BLF格式中,数据记录是根据一定的规则和结构组织的。每个BLF...
trace转换工具,适用于bmr/mdf/mat/asc/blf格式
"trace转换工具"就是这样一个专门处理特定格式日志文件的实用程序,它能够处理BMR、MDF、MAT、ASC以及BLF这五种不同的日志格式。这些格式在不同的应用和系统环境中各有用途,理解它们的含义和作用对于有效地利用这个...
dbc文件转excel
汽车can总线下的dbc解析文件,用spy或者canoe什么的看起来太麻烦,系统的人就是想要看excel,么就搞了个dbc转excel工具,用python写的 具体使用方法:...
最新推荐






